Define Timestamp ordering
Ans In timestamp-based method, a serial order is made among the concurrent transaction by assigning to every transaction a unique nondecreasing number. The common value assigned to each transaction is the system clock value at the beginning of the transaction, therefore the name timestamp ordering. This value then can be employed in deciding the order in which the conflict between two transactions is resolved. A transaction along with a smaller timestamp value is considered to be an "older" transaction as compared to another transaction with a larger timestamp value.
